summary: From 1947 until 1963, a small group of psychiatrists from the Tuskegee Veterans Administration Hospital ran a Mental Hygiene Clinic designed to provide outpatient care and education to the Black residents of Macon County, Alabama. In an analysis of the clinic and the work of its Director, Dr. Prince Barker, we see the ways that Black psychiatrists tried to develop an antiracist approach to psychiatry and to develop their own autonomy in segregated Alabama. Dr. Robert Russa Moton was an African American educator and author. He served as an administrator at Hampton Institute, a private historically Black university in Hampton, Virginia, that provided education to freedmen. In 1915 he was named principal of Tuskegee Institute (now University), after the death of founder Booker T. Washington. Under his leadership, Tuskegee transformed into one of the premier institutes dedicated to educating African Americans. Dr. Moton also served as an advisor to several U.S. presidents.
